Interventions
DIETARY_SUPPLEMENT

Octanoic acid (1-13C, 99%)

"13C-marker will be mixed with emulsions. 2 isovolumetric (200 ml) and isocaloric (200 kcal) lipid emulsions with different acid and shear stability Lipid emulsion 1: acid stable, particle size 0.6 µm~Optional study pending interim analysis:~Lipid emulsion 4: acid unstable, redispersible by mechanical processes during antral contractions and passage through the pylorus, particle size 0.6 µm"
